Title: The interaction of formic acid with Pt(111) and the effect of coadsorbed water, atomic oxygen, and carbon monoxide

We have investigated the reaction of HCOOH with the (111) surface of platinum and its dependence on surface temperature, surface concentration (coverage), and the presence of other adspecies such as H{sub 2}O, CO, and atomic oxygen. The motivation for this investigation originates in the electrochemical community, where an interest in the development of fuel cells has existed for years. Small oxygen-containing hydrocarbons like HCOOH show potential as fuels in cells utilizing platinum as the electrode material. The desired reaction in such a cell is the decomposition of the formic acid to produce CO{sub 2}, which desorbs from the electrode surface; however, a competing reaction produces adspecies which do not desorb. The accumulation of these adspecies prevents continued adsorption and reaction of formic acid and eventually renders the cell useless. We have probed the reaction of formic acid with Pt(111) in ultrahigh vacuum via thermal desorption spectroscopy and high resolution electron energy loss spectroscopy.
